Transaction 7045ad32f709683d5fb91b2328a57f592b2ff5e81e1445591f4ae101000c999b
1 Input
1 Output
-
7045ad32f709683d5fb91b2328a57f592b2ff5e81e1445591f4ae101000c999b:0
- value
- 1415666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f6ce20206dddda26ea53d6ddf874f368ee25d0c OP_EQUAL
- address
- 3EmNzHfQFBMBkdfax2WBASRa7aV11CXWHe